These can be made with recycled items that you probably have laying around the house. For each whistle, we used: - 1 toilet paper tube or 1/2 of a paper towel tube - 1 small square of wax paper -1 rubber band The children decorated their paper towel rolls with markers. When they were finished, I poked a small hole near one end of the roll with scissors. We used the rubber band to secure the waxed paper to the same end of the roll that I had poked a hole in. Loud Foghorn From Plumbing Parts: This is a how to for building a loud foghorn from easy to get plumbing fittings and an inexpensive double acting air pump, the idea was to emulate the hand operated type used on small ships until the 1950's shown in pic 2.
